Good luck with the FPV endeavor.  I bought a cinewhoop drone a couple of years back but every time I tried flying it I would get vertigo or dizziness.  I even tried flying it while sitting down and still got light headed.  I was told It is caused when there is a disconnect between what your eyes see and what your body feels.  So I sold it and haven't tried FPV since.

Cacike47 Posted at 3-10 11:23
I was wondering the same especially since any kind real estate in this area would be very expensive.
While there I noticed quite a few of these pipe sticking out of the ground which look very similar to the ones at the RC club, I fly at.  If they are the same then these pipes measure the level of methane from a prior waste dump. So that's one possibility besides the land owner's desire for a price too high at this point. The area would make a good commercial waterfront investment although there are already a few up and down river.

Since it's what we call a Brownfield site ( former industry and chance of toxic pollution) that tends to rule out housing development unless the land is cleaned first. If there's methane from a former waste dump that would explain it.
